电饭煲模糊控制的方法主要依赖于电饭煲的模糊控制器。以下是一种常见的模糊控制方法:
- 确定输入变量和输出变量:
- 输入变量:如水量(H)、温度(T)等,这些变量可以通过电饭煲的传感器实时获取。
-
输出变量:如煮饭时间(t)或煮饭程度(S),这些变量反映了电饭煲的工作状态。
-
建立模糊集:
-
定义模糊集合,例如,对于水量(H),可以有“少”、“中”、“多”等模糊集合;对于温度(T),可以有“低温”、“常温”、“高温”等模糊集合。
-
设定隶属函数:
-
为每个模糊集合定义隶属函数,描述了变量值属于该集合的程度。例如,可以使用梯形或高斯函数来定义隶属函数。
-
构建模糊控制规则:
-
根据经验和需求,制定一系列模糊控制规则。例如,如果水量很少,那么可能需要增加煮饭时间;如果温度过高,可能需要降低煮饭时间。规则可以表示为“如果...那么...”的形式。
-
模糊推理:
-
利用模糊逻辑推理机,根据输入变量的模糊值和预设的模糊控制规则,计算出输出变量的模糊值。这通常涉及到解模糊过程,即将模糊的输出值转化为具体的控制指令。
-
执行控制:
-
将计算出的模糊控制指令转化为实际的电饭煲操作,如调整加热功率、控制水位等。
-
反馈与调整:
- 在电饭煲工作过程中,不断收集传感器数据,并根据实际工作状态对模糊控制规则进行修正和调整,以提高控制精度和效率。
请注意,具体的模糊控制方法和规则可能因电饭煲型号、品牌和使用场景的不同而有所差异。在实际应用中,建议根据具体情况进行调整和优化。